Nestled in the heart of downtown Indianapolis and directly connected to the Indiana Convention Center, this state-of-the-art 800-room hotel is poised to redefine meetings and events in the city. Boasting over 100,000 square feet of versatile meeting space, including an expansive ballroom and unique dining experiences, Signia Indianapolis will elevate hospitality in one of the Midwest's most vibrant destinations. As the Revenue Management Director, you will play a crucial role in optimizing group and transient inventories to achieve an ideal balance between demand and availability, all while ensuring exceptional guest service and financial success. Key Responsibilities: Oversee and optimize controls for group and transient inventory, including room accommodations, rates, and inventory management in collaboration with the Front Office. Act as the primary liaison with Front Office, Sales and Marketing, and Reservations to maximize inventory and profitability. Develop, monitor, and adjust sales and pricing strategies to align with market demand. Conduct competitive and demand analyses to critically evaluate strategies, room statistics, and general demand factors for efficient inventory management. Perform forecasting, review competitive data, assess demand and event calendars, and maintain historical performance data. Support team member development through supervision, professional growth opportunities, scheduling, performance evaluations, and recognition. Recruit, interview, and train new team members to build a high-performing department. Manage departmental functions and facilitate team meetings.
